I fairly new to the hobby. I think I have an issue with stabilizing my ALK. I’ve been working on setting up my BRS 2 Part Doser. this is where I'm at. Dosing CAL at 72 ml during the day and that’s been stable at 410. Currently I’ve dosed ALK at 200 ml at night. Trying to maintain 8 dk. I'd be ok with 7 but its dropped below 6dk . So I'd like a little wiggle room. Testing every two days at 6:30 am and I’m finding that I drop about 1dk every two days. So I manually add 200 ml at that time and then adjust the timer to dose more ALK and retest two days later and repeat.

Does all this seem reasonable? I’m losing my Elegance coral and I’ve lost both Open brain corals.

125g Mixed Reef.
Ammonia 0, Nitrite 0, Nitrate 0, PO4 0, Alk 7, Cal 410, Mag 1275, PH 8.2

2 Yellow Tangs, Valentino Puffer, 3 Blue/green Chromis, 2 Snowflake Clowns, Melanurus Wrasse, Bi Color Angel, Blood red Fire Shrimp, Scarlet Shrimp, Sand sifting star fish, Assorted snails

Small cluster of Birds nest, Frog Spawn Coral, Xina, Kenya tree, Zoas, Candy canes, Hammer coral, Elegance coral, GSP

I doubt you lost corals due to the alk, but I can't rule it out.

That said your plan to get to a good daily dose seems fine.

I'd personally match the calcium to the determined alk dose until the calcium actually seemed to be rising too high (since it is much slower to respond to over or under dosing, you are likely underdosing it and just do not see the effects yet).
